Linux vi vim 編輯檔案相關命令和快捷鍵

2021-10-09 01:14:23 字數 640 閱讀 4321

1、開啟某個檔案,輸入vi或者vim

2、開啟檔案後預設在第一行,可以按「g」,即「shift+g」,跳到最後一行,按gg可以回到第一行

3、跳到當前行的末尾:按「$」鍵,即「shift+4」

4、跳到當前行的開頭:在當前行按「0」

5、重新載入檔案(可能修改了之後,需要還原回去) :e!

6、單行複製 將游標移到複製行 按 'yy'進行複製

7、多行複製 將游標移到複製行 按 'nyy'進行複製,n表示1,2,3,4等等,

比如按3,表示複製包括當前行及下面2行,共複製3行

8、貼上 將游標移到當前行 按 'p'進行貼上,會將複製的內容放到當前行的下面

9、查詢檔案裡的內容 /關鍵字 ,比如輸入/linux,會跳轉到檔案裡第一次出現linux這個單詞的地方

10、刪除當前行:輸入dd,會刪除當前行

11、刪除多行:ndd,刪除包括當前行開始的共n行,比如2dd,共刪除兩行

12、dg 刪除游標所在到最後一行的所有資料

13、d0(數字0)刪除游標所在到該行的第乙個字元

14、d$ 刪除游標所在處,到該行的最後乙個字元

15、儲存修改後的檔案按兩次esc,然後輸入wq!

16、放棄修改,即不儲存檔案:按兩次esc,然後輸入q!

linux vi vim編輯檔案顯示行號

方法一 最尷尬的方法 1 顯示當前行行號,在vi的命令模式下輸入 nu2 顯示所有行號,在vi的命令模式下輸入 set nu 這是 set number 的簡寫方法二 最好的方法 root localhost vi vimrc 生成.vimrc檔案,在第一行輸入如下內容 set number vi ...

Linux Vi Vim編輯器命令基礎

vi是乙個命令列介面下的文字編輯工具,vim是vi的乙個增強版。vim或vi命令可以啟動vim編輯器 vim 目標檔案路徑 使用vim開啟檔案 如果目標檔案存在,則vim開啟該檔案 如果目標檔案不存在,則vim會新建該檔案,並開啟 vi的三種模式 1 命令模式 常規模式 任何模式下按esc鍵都會返回...

Linux VI VIM 編輯器基本操作

三種模式 一般模式 預設模式 編輯模式 命令模式 效果dd 刪除游標當前行 dnd刪除 n 行 u撤銷上一步 x x 刪除乙個字母 delete 刪除乙個支部 backspace yy複製游標當前行p貼上 dw刪除乙個詞 yw複製乙個詞 shift g 移動到頁尾 數字 shift g 移動到指定行...